In the United States, electrical compliance services are governed by a set of regulations known as the National Electrical Code (NEC). The NEC outlines the minimum standards for electrical installation and maintenance to ensure the safety of people and property. Businesses are required to comply with the NEC to avoid fines, penalties, or legal liabilities resulting from noncompliance.
Additionally, businesses must adhere to local building codes, safety standards, and industry-specific regulations to remain in compliance with electrical requirements. Failure to meet these standards not only puts employees and customers at risk but also exposes businesses to potential lawsuits, insurance claims, and reputational damage.

During an electrical compliance service, technicians will conduct a thorough inspection of an organization’s electrical systems to identify any issues or potential hazards. They will test the functionality of electrical equipment, check for damaged or outdated components, and assess the overall safety of the system. Based on their findings, technicians will recommend any necessary repairs or upgrades to bring the system into compliance with regulations.
